Well, buying a condo for occasional vacation use has it's own problems. You certainly can use it when you want but what about the rest of the year? Be careful and do your homework. My suggestion - don't buy anything, just rent a timeshare from an owner. [Q=michael3092] There is a difference in owning a condo for use an entire year than paying $1,500 to $1,900 maintenance for a one week use of a timeshare, Let’s use a condo with an association fee of $5,000 annually, 5,000 taxes and $5,000 more for utilities and other costs. That’s $15.000 or 52 weeks or $288.00 per week. With your own condo you are not on a waiting list to use it and even that mandatory 10-13 months needed in advance.[/Q]
